A talk and discussion led by the Very Reverend David Fergusson, Regius Professor of Divinity at the University of Cambridge.

The theme of creation has often been understated in the seasons of the Christian year, the creeds, and the liturgy. This talk explores the reasons for this and proposes ways in which our churches can learn to value the created world for its own sake and not merely for its human benefits.

Professor Fergusson has had a long academic career, as well as serving as a parish minister early in his career. He was recently described as “the most distinguished theologian in Britain” and his talk is sure to be thought-provoking. In 2019 the Queen appointed him as Dean of the Chapel Royal in Scotland and Dean of the Order of the Thistle; both of which he still holds.

St Peter and St Paul has stood at the top of Hambledon's historic High Street since Saxon times.  

We are part of a Benefice which includes the churches at Soberton and Newtown, with whom we share our vicar, Rev Liz Quinn.  We are also part of the wider Meon Valley Parishes (MVP), which brings together eight churches.
